Which two sets of reactants best represents the amphoteric character of $\mathrm{Zn}(\mathrm{OH})_{2}$ ?
Set I $\operatorname{Zn}(\mathrm{OH})_{2}(\mathrm{~s})$ and $\mathrm{OH}(a q)$
Set II $\mathrm{Zn}(\mathrm{OH})_{2}(\mathrm{~s})$ and $\mathrm{H}_{2} \mathrm{O}(I)$
Set III Zn $(\mathrm{OH})_{2}(\mathrm{~s})$ and $\mathrm{H}^{+}(a q)$
Set $\mathrm{IV} \mathrm{Zn}(\mathrm{OH})_{2}(\mathrm{~s})$ and $\mathrm{NH}_{3}(a q)$

The correct answer is:
I and III

The amphoteric character of $\mathrm{Zn}(\mathrm{OH})_{2}$ is represented by I and III
